12.11.2014 - Zimbabwe’s Sovereign Wealth Fund put into gear
Zimbabwe’s Treasury will with immediate effect remit a quarter of mining royalties to the Sovereign Wealth Fund (SWF) after President Robert Mugabe yesterday signed into law a bill to set up the fund, which is meant to secure investments for future generations and support economic growth. A sovereign wealth fund is a state-managed pool of money drawn from the country’s reserves, set aside for investment in strategic areas that benefit the economy and its citizens.
